We aimed to evaluate the effect a regular inspiratory muscle training program on autonomic modulation measured by heart rate variability, exercise capacity and respiratory function in chronic obstructive pulmonary disease subjects (COPD).
Single-center controlled study, with balanced randomization (1:1 for two arms).
A COPD reference hospital localized in Sao Luís, Brazil.
22 COPD subjects joined the study.
Three times a week for four weeks inspiratory muscle training (IMT) at 30% of PI.
Pulmonary capacities and inspiratory pressure, total six-minute walk test and, cardiac autonomic modulation.
The intervention group showed improvements in the cardiac autonomic modulation, with increased vagal modulation (total variability and HF [ms; adjusted p < 0.05]); increased expiratory and inspiratory capacities and, increased distance in the 6-min walk test.
12 weeks of IMT at 30% of the maximal inspiratory pressure increased cardiac autonomic modulation, expiratory and inspiratory and exercise capacity in COPD subjects.
